7.1 Setting
the
Password
Policy
Passwords
have
limitations
such
as
length
and
character
type.
Those
password
attributes
conform
to
rules
called
the
password
policy.
The
current
password
policy
applies
to
every
user
account
that
is
created.
For
this
reason,
check
the
current
password
policy,
and
adjust
the
password
policy
as
needed
before
creating
any
user
account.
1.
Execute
the
showpasswordpolicy
command
to
check
the
password
policy.
